What is ETS Electrofishing Systems?
Based in Madison, Wisconsin, ETS Electrofishing Systems serves as a critical provider of specialized electrofishing hardware, including stream barge, boat, and backpack configurations. With a legacy spanning over three decades, the company distinguishes itself through a modular design philosophy that prioritizes repairability and long-term upgradeability. Their market position is defined by a deep integration into the workflows of federal, state, and private agencies, where precision and reliability in aquatic data collection are paramount. By focusing on user-centric controls and tailored engineering, the firm maintains a competitive edge in the niche market of fisheries management and environmental assessment tools.
